Xerox Phaser 6010 usb id string not recognized by cups

Johan Cockx johan at sikanda.be
Sat Jun 25 05:18:21 PDT 2011


I'm running openSUSE 11.4 (x86_64), with Cups 1.4

When I plug in my new Xerox Phaser 6010 printer via USB, it is recognized as a usb printer,  but not visible in Cups (e.g., http://localhost:631/admin/ > Add Printer does not see it).

After some experiments (see http://forums.opensuse.org/english/get-technical-help-here/hardware/461852-xerox-phaser-6010-usb-printer-not-detected-2.html),  I found that the following errors are added /var/log/cups/error_log each time I connect the printer:

I [23/Jun/2011:18:00:54 +0200] Started "/usr/lib/cups/daemon/cups-deviced" (pid=2695)
E [23/Jun/2011:18:00:54 +0200] [cups-deviced] Bad line from "usb": direct usb://Xerox/Phaser%206010N "Xerox Phaser 6010N" "Xerox Phaser 6010N" "MFG:Xerox;CMD:HBPL;MDL:Phaser 6010N;DES:Xerox Phaser 6010 Color Laser Printer, Letter/A4 Size;CLS:PRINTER;STS:AAAWAQD/AP8AAAAAAAQAAWQDZANkA2QDAAAAAAADUAAAAAAAAAAAAAAAAAAAAAAA4AAAAAAAAAAQ
E [23/Jun/2011:18:00:54 +0200] [cups-deviced] Bad line from "usb": DA==;" ""

My impression is that the USB identification string sent by the printer is not correctly parsed by Cups.

Should I enter this as a bug?
Below is the output of some commands that may help to analyze the problem

# dmesg | tail
[98138.537455] usb 1-3.2: new high speed USB device using ehci_hcd and address 21
[98138.613073] usb 1-3.2: New USB device found, idVendor=0924, idProduct=3d68
[98138.613082] usb 1-3.2: New USB device strings: Mfr=1, Product=2, SerialNumber=3
[98138.613090] usb 1-3.2: Product: Phaser 6010N
[98138.613095] usb 1-3.2: Manufacturer: Xerox
[98138.613100] usb 1-3.2: SerialNumber: YXR101090
[98138.615039] usblp0: USB Bidirectional printer dev 21 if 0 alt 0 proto 2 vid 0x0924 pid 0x3D68

# lsusb
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 002 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 001 Device 013: ID 05e3:0608 Genesys Logic, Inc. USB-2.0 4-Port HUB
Bus 002 Device 002: ID 058f:9254 Alcor Micro Corp. Hub
Bus 002 Device 003: ID 413c:2003 Dell Computer Corp. Keyboard
Bus 002 Device 004: ID 046d:c00e Logitech, Inc. M-BJ58/M-BJ69 Optical Wheel Mouse
Bus 002 Device 005: ID 10d5:55a2 Uni Class Technology Co., Ltd 2Port KVMSwitcher
Bus 001 Device 015: ID 03f0:0205 Hewlett-Packard ScanJet 3300c
Bus 001 Device 016: ID 0924:3d68 Xerox

# /usr/lib/cups/backend/usb
direct usb://Xerox/Phaser%206010N "Xerox Phaser 6010N" "Xerox Phaser 6010N" "MFG:Xerox;CMD:HBPL;MDL:Phaser 6010N;DES:Xerox Phaser 6010 Color Laser Printer, Letter/A4 Size;CLS:PRINTER;STS:AAARBAD/AP8AAAAAAAQAAWQDZANkA2QDAAAAAAADUAAAAAAAAAAAAAAAAAAAAAAA4AAAAAAAAAAQ
DA==;" ""




More information about the cups mailing list